createssh for Dummies
createssh for Dummies
Blog Article
You will find usually some additional action or two required to adopt a more secure way of Doing the job. And most people do not like it. They really like lessen security and the lack of friction. That's human nature.
I understand I'm able to make this happen with ssh -i domestically on my machine, but what I’m in search of is a means so which the server previously understands which key to look for. Cheers!
The last bit of the puzzle is controlling passwords. It could get really cumbersome coming into a password anytime you initialize an SSH link. To have all-around this, we can easily utilize the password administration software package that includes macOS and a variety of Linux distributions.
For this tutorial we will use macOS's Keychain Access plan. Begin by adding your important to your Keychain Entry by passing -K option to the ssh-increase command:
rsa - an old algorithm according to The issue of factoring significant numbers. A important size of at the least 2048 bits is suggested for RSA; 4096 bits is best. RSA is finding outdated and significant developments are increasingly being manufactured in factoring.
Prior to finishing the techniques In this particular segment, Be sure that you possibly have SSH crucial-based authentication configured for the root account on this server, or if possible, that you have SSH essential-based authentication configured for an account on this server with sudo access.
You are able to manually produce the SSH vital utilizing the ssh-keygen command. It results in the private and non-private from the $Property/.ssh spot.
Every system has its have actions and issues. Developing various SSH keys for various websites is straightforward — just give Each and every crucial a unique title in the era course of action. Regulate and transfer these keys properly to prevent losing entry to servers and accounts.
Really don't try and do anything at all with SSH keys till you have confirmed You can utilize SSH with passwords to connect to the focus on Personal computer.
while in the look for createssh bar and Check out the box next to OpenSSH Shopper. Then, click on Subsequent to setup the attribute.
Host keys are just standard SSH crucial pairs. Every host might have a single host crucial for every algorithm. The host keys are almost always saved in the following files:
When you desired to create a number of keys for various websites that is easy far too. Say, as an example, you wished to use the default keys we just produced for just a server you've got on Electronic Ocean, and you simply needed to produce A different list of keys for GitHub. You'd Stick to the similar process as over, but when it came time to avoid wasting your critical you would just give it another identify such as "id_rsa_github" or some thing equivalent.
Your macOS or Linux working technique really should have already got the conventional OpenSSH suite of tools mounted. This suite includes the utility ssh-keygen, which you will use to produce a pair of SSH keys.
Once the above circumstances are accurate, log into your remote server with SSH keys, either as root or with the account with sudo privileges. Open the SSH daemon’s configuration file: